After Testing 19 Hot Tubs, We Found 7 That We Think Are Actually Worth Your Money

This article reviews 19 different hot tubs, ranging from inflatable to traditional hard-shell models, after extensive testing in real-world backyard settings for up to six months. The evaluation criteria included design, size accuracy, maintenance requirements, unique features, and long-term durability, aiming to provide comprehensive recommendations for various needs and budgets. A key finding from the testing was that while manufacturers often overstate occupancy, inflatable hot tubs can offer a relaxing experience comparable to more expensive models, sometimes even including jets, lighting, and speakers. The Aqualife Current Outdoor Hot Tub was selected as the best overall, praised for its straightforward setup, quick filling, reasonable heat-up time (approximately 24 hours to reach the desired temperature), and comfortable lounger seat. Although rated for four people, it was found to be most comfortable for two, with non-adjustable jets being a minor drawback. Its main features include 14 jets, a color-changing light, and cup holders. For budget-conscious consumers, the Intex PureSpa Bubble Massage Inflatable Hot Tub, priced under $1,000, emerged as the best budget option. It offers easy setup, thermal-resistant foam for temperature retention, and a comfortable, spacious design for up to five people, despite being listed for six. Maintenance involves using a chlorine dispenser ball and a built-in filter, with water changes recommended every few months. This model focuses on core bubble massage and heating functionalities without additional special features like lights. The Intex PureSpa Plus Inflatable Round Hot Tub was identified as the best inflatable option, offering 170 bubble jets and a built-in hard water treatment system at a lower cost than many traditional models. It comes with several accessories, including an insulated cover, LED light, and inflatable headrests. Setup was found to be lengthy, primarily due to confusing instructions that apply to multiple models, and heating took about 32 hours. While marketed for six, it comfortably accommodates four. This model is ideal for beginner hot tub users and can be deflated and stored during colder months, although it is slightly more fragile than hard-shell versions. The Intex 4-Person Inflatable Square Hot Tub was recognized for its best features, including adjustable cushioning, a fun color-changing LED light with seven color options, and a wireless remote control. It also supports app control, though Wi-Fi compatibility issues with 5Ghz networks were noted. The hot tub provides relaxing spa bubbles and adjustable headrest cushions. Like other inflatables, its advertised four-person capacity was found to be tighter than ideal, fitting two to three adults more comfortably. Setup is easy, taking about an hour, with heating to full temperature in approximately six hours, making it suitable for couples or occasional use. For smaller spaces, the Aquarest Pumps Plug And Play Hot Tub was chosen as the best two-person model. It features 20 adjustable stainless steel massage jets, bucket-style seats with lumbar support, and a backlit LED waterfall with nine color settings. While costly for its capacity, its plug-and-play design simplifies installation, though purchasing separate steps is recommended for easier entry and exit. Long-term use revealed minor discoloration on the control panel and waterfall acrylic, suggesting that regular maintenance, including chlorine application and water level checks, is crucial. Finally, the Aquarest Spas Select 150 Plug-and-Play Hot Tub was named the best four-person hot tub for its affordability under $3,000, comprehensive features, and ease of use. It includes 12 stainless steel hydrotherapy jets, a backlit waterfall, four cup holders, a locking safety cover, and a patented water filtration system. It plugs into a standard 120-volt outlet and warms to 104 degrees Fahrenheit in about 24 hours. While ideal for two adults and two children, four adults might find it slightly crowded. Maintenance is straightforward, involving weekly filter rinsing and chemical checks, with full draining and refilling every three to four months. The Alfi Brand Round Wood Fired Hot Tub was highlighted as the best wood-fired option, notable for its unique, portable design and independence from electricity. It heats water via a wood fire in an integrated pit, protected by extended pipes and a stainless steel windscreen. Made from antimicrobial, UV- and freeze-resistant material, it takes about three hours to heat 130 to 220 gallons to 100 degrees Fahrenheit.
